1. Pay attention to soil conditions. Bio-potash fertilizer performs best on loamy soils rich in organic matter, alkali-hydrolyzable nitrogen, and available phosphorus. It is not recommended for sandy soils that are too loose or have poor water and nutrient retention. Soils with available potassium levels below 100 ppm will see the most significant improvement when bio-potash is applied. This type of fertilizer is especially effective in potassium-deficient soils, as it helps unlock and release essential nutrients for plant uptake.
2. Consider irrigation areas. In fields with good irrigation facilities, bio-potash fertilizer can significantly boost crop yields. However, in dryland areas without irrigation, the microbial activity required for nutrient transformation may not be sufficient, leading to limited effectiveness. Field trials have shown that using bio-potash in high-nutrient environments—such as those with high nitrogen and phosphorus content—can help balance nutrient supply and improve overall yield. This makes it a great complement to traditional chemical fertilizers.
3. Prioritize its use on multi-crop systems and sorghum crops. These crops benefit greatly from the slow-release properties of bio-potash, which supports long-term growth and enhances nutrient availability throughout the growing season.
4. When storing and applying bio-potash fertilizer, avoid direct sunlight. Seed coating should be done indoors or under shelter to protect the microbial cultures. The seeds should be dried in the shade, not in direct sunlight. It's best to apply the seed dressing on the same day it is prepared to maintain the viability of the beneficial microorganisms.
5. Bio-potash can be combined with urea, ammonium nitrate, ammonium sulfate, potassium sulfate, and potassium chloride for top-dressing. However, it should not be stored after mixing; it must be used immediately. Avoid mixing it with alkaline materials like wood ash, as this can kill the bacterial cultures and reduce its effectiveness.
6. Keep in mind that once bio-potash is applied to the soil, it takes time for the microbes to break down and release potassium and phosphorus from mineral sources. To ensure these nutrients are available during the early stages of plant growth, it's crucial to apply the fertilizer early—before planting, during seed dressing, or at transplanting. Early application ensures maximum benefit. If used as a top-dressing, it should be applied early in the seedling stage. The later the application, the less effective it becomes.
7. Apply the fertilizer close to the roots. The closer it is to the root zone, the better, as this allows the microbes to interact directly with the plant and enhance nutrient uptake efficiently.
8. Be mindful of environmental conditions, such as temperature and moisture. These factors play a key role in the performance of microbial agents. Maintaining optimal conditions will help the bacteria thrive and deliver the best results.

Magnetic Bead Swab Sample Viral DNA/RNA Extraction Kit can be used to isolate and purify high-quality viral DNA/RNA from various swabs and virus culture supernatants. By using magnetic beads with unique separation function and carefully optimized buffer system to efficiently capture the released nucleic acid, the extracted nucleic acid has high yield and good quality, which is suitable for various downstream application experiments, such as RT-qPCR, qPCR and other experiments.
